No, there is no direct train from Turnhout to London. However, there are services departing from Turnhout station and arriving at London station via Bruxelles-Midi.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 4h 8m.
Turnhout to London train services, operated by Belgian Railways (NMBS/SNCB), depart from Turnhout station.
Turnhout to London train services, operated by Belgian Railways (NMBS/SNCB), arrive at London St Pancras Intl station.

The distance between Turnhout and London is 352.3 km. The road distance is 450 km.
You can take a train from Turnhout to London St Pancras Intl via Brussel-Zuid / Bruxelles-Midi in around 4h 24m.
